Homecoming is a national tradition ” but the dresses? Those are deeply, fascinatingly local. Walk into a high school gymnasium in Dallas and you'll see something dramatically different from what's happening at a homecoming in Portland, Miami, or Manhattan. Regional identity, climate, cultural heritage, and local fashion ecosystems all conspire to create distinct homecoming dress aesthetics that shift meaningfully from state to state. Here's what's actually happening across the country ” and why it matters for anyone shopping for homecoming dresses right now.

 

Why Homecoming Fashion Is Hyper Regional

Before diving into state by state specifics, it's worth understanding why regional variation exists at all. Several forces drive it simultaneously.

Climate is the most obvious factor: a student in Phoenix choosing her homecoming dress in October is dealing with very different conditions than one in Minnesota. Fabric weight, sleeve coverage, and layering potential all shift with local weather patterns.

Cultural identity plays an equally significant role. States with strong regional identities ” Texas, Louisiana, New York, California ” have homecoming aesthetics that reflect those identities rather than simply following national retail trends. Local boutiques in these regions often carry inventory specifically curated to match community taste rather than national bestseller lists.

Socioeconomic patterns matter too. In areas with higher average household income, designer influenced or luxury fabric homecoming looks are more common. In communities where homecoming is primarily about fun and dancing rather than formal presentation, shorter, more energetic silhouettes dominate.

Finally, social media creates fascinating micro trends within specific schools and cities ” a particular style will spread through a local network and suddenly define what homecoming looks like in one zip code without having much impact twenty miles away.

 The South: Go Big or Go Home

In Southern states ” Georgia, Alabama, Mississippi, Louisiana, Tennessee, and the Carolinas ” homecoming dresses trend toward the maximalist end of the spectrum. Formal is the default register. Long homecoming dresses with full skirts, structured bodices, and substantial embellishment are genuinely common, even at events where the rest of the country would choose something shorter and less formal.

Red homecoming dresses and black homecoming styles are perennially popular across the South, but the real signature is the ball gown silhouette applied to homecoming specifically. In many Southern schools, homecoming carries a cultural significance approaching prom ” the full formal experience is expected, not exceptional.

Texas deserves its own category. Texas homecoming is legendary for scale and formality. Mums (elaborate chrysanthemum corsage traditions) aside, the dresses themselves lean toward glamorous floor length gowns, strapless silhouettes, and statement fabrics. Pink homecoming dress styles in blush and hot pink are enormously popular, as are royal blue homecoming dresses and rich jewel tones. The Texas aesthetic is confident, bold, and unapologetically statement making.

 The Northeast: Sophisticated, Urban, and Fashion Forward

In New York, Massachusetts, Connecticut, and New Jersey, homecoming dress trends track more closely with fashion forward urban aesthetics than anywhere else in the country. Here, shorter silhouettes dominate ” short homecoming dresses, cocktail dresses, and sophisticated midi styles outperform the full ball gown. The reference point isn't princess fantasy; it's young, stylish, editorial.

Black hoco dress styles are enormously popular in the Northeast, reflecting the region's affinity for refined, unfussy elegance. Sleek silhouettes in bold solid colors ” black, cobalt, deep burgundy ” with clean lines and minimal embellishment reflect a fashion sensibility that values cool confidence over sparkle. New York area students in particular are influenced by the city's fashion week culture, which trickles down into school formal aesthetics in ways that simply don't happen in more rural regions.

 The Pacific Coast: Easy Glamour and Bold Individuality

California, Oregon, and Washington present a homecoming dress culture built around individual expression rather than conformity to a single dominant aesthetic. The Pacific Coast's cultural emphasis on personal authenticity means the dress landscape is genuinely diverse ” you'll see everything from flowy bohemian maxi dresses to sharp structured minis to maximalist sequin looks at the same homecoming event.

That said, certain patterns emerge. California homecoming leans toward lighter fabrics, brighter colors, and more skin forward silhouettes reflecting a year round warm weather lifestyle and cultural comfort with the body. Blue homecoming dresses in vivid ocean inspired shades are popular, as are warm sunset tones ” coral, tangerine, golden yellow ” that feel authentically Californian rather than trend chased.

Oregon and Washington's homecoming aesthetic incorporates a bit more edge: dark color palettes, velvet fabrics even for homecoming, unexpected silhouettes, and styling that borrows from the region's indie fashion culture. Black homecoming and deep jewel tones dominate over pastels in the Pacific Northwest in ways that distinguish it sharply from Southern California's brighter palette.


 The Midwest: Approachable Glamour With a Practical Edge

Ohio, Illinois, Michigan, Indiana, Wisconsin ” the Midwest has a homecoming dress culture characterized by what might be called "approachable glamour." Here, the social dynamics of homecoming tend toward inclusivity and fun rather than high fashion performance, which shapes the aesthetic significantly.

Midi and knee length homecoming dresses are enormously popular across the Midwest, offering a balance between dressed up and practical. Sequins and embellishment appear but typically in more restrained applications than in Southern or Texan contexts. Pink homecoming dress options ” from blush to hot pink ” are consistently among the top sellers, as are navy and red homecoming dresses in classic, unfussy silhouettes.

 Florida and the Gulf Coast: Color, Skin, and Celebration

Florida homecoming dress culture is its own category. The state's year round heat, multicultural population, and genuine party forward social culture create a homecoming aesthetic that prioritizes color intensity, skin visibility, and unapologetic confidence.

Red hoco dress styles are enormously popular in Florida ” vivid, saturated reds in short silhouettes that photograph beautifully against Florida's lush backdrops. Two piece homecoming sets, cutout details, and bodycon silhouettes are all significantly more common in Florida than in most other states. The formality register is lower but the overall impact is often higher ” more celebration energy, less traditional elegance.

Miami's cultural influence creates a distinct subset of Florida homecoming fashion that incorporates Latin American formal dress traditions: embellishment, rich color, and beautiful quality fabrication applied to contemporary silhouettes. Blue homecoming dresses in electric or tropical shades, vivid greens, and bright fuchsia are all popular in South Florida in ways that differ from the rest of the state and the country.


 The Mountain West and Southwest: Desert Color Palettes and Western Influence

Arizona, New Mexico, Colorado, and Nevada homecoming fashion reflects both the landscape and the region's Western cultural heritage in interesting ways. Earth tones ” terracotta, rust, warm camel, sage ” appear in homecoming dress shopping patterns in ways they simply don't in other regions. Deep turquoise blue, influenced by Southwest Native American color traditions and landscape aesthetics, is a distinctly regional favorite.

Colorado and the Mountain West also show strong outdoor culture influence: practical silhouettes, fabrics that work in variable October temperatures (homecoming season can be genuinely cold at altitude), and layering potential matter here in ways they don't in Miami or Phoenix. Students in Denver are genuinely thinking about whether they can wear a wrap or jacket over their hoco dress without ruining the look ” a concern that rarely occurs to students in Texas or California.


 Shopping Across Regional Lines: The Online Opportunity

One significant shift reshaping this entire landscape is the democratization of formal wear shopping through online retail. Students in rural Montana or small town Mississippi who previously had access only to local boutiques ” often with limited selection ” now have access to the same homecoming dresses near me search results as students in major urban centers.

This has created a fascinating dynamic: regional aesthetics are partly preserved through local community influence and school social networks, but partly homogenized as shoppers across the country access the same trend forward inventory from national online retailers.
